Presidente Dutra weather in September

In September, Presidente Dutra sees average daytime highs of 35°C and overnight lows near 23°C, with 8 mm of rain across 1.7 wet days and about 12 hours of daylight. It is the 1st-warmest and 10th-wettest month of the year here.

Day-to-day highs hold fairly steady near 35°C through the month. The sky is clear or mostly clear about 69% of the time in September, and the air most often feels muggy.

Daylight stretches from about 11 h 54 min at the start of September to 12 hours by month's end. Set against the rest of the year, September is Presidente Dutra's 2nd-clearest and 3rd-windiest month. For the whole year in context, see Presidente Dutra's year-round climate.

Temperature in September

Average highAverage lowShaded bands: 10–90% of days

Day-to-day highs hold fairly steady near 35°C through the month.

A typical September day in Presidente Dutra reaches about 35°C in the afternoon and slips back to 23°C overnight — a 12°C spread between the day's warmth and the night's chill. On most days the high lands between 34°C and 37°C. Set against its neighbours, September runs about 1°C warmer than August and on par with October.

Air quality in Presidente Dutra in September

GoodModeratePoorUnhealthyVery unhealthy

Average fine-particle pollution (PM2.5) through the year — so you can see where September falls, not just the annual average.

Air quality in Presidente Dutra is worst in October — around 55 µg/m³ PM2.5 (unhealthy), about 6.3× the cleanest month (June, 9 µg/m³).

Modeled monthly averages (CAMS reanalysis, 2015–2024).

Location & terrain

Where is Presidente Dutra?

Presidente Dutra sits at 5.3°S, 44.5°W, 108 m above sea level, in Brazil. The nearest listed city is Tuntum, 18 km away.

Topography around Presidente Dutra

How much the land rises and falls, and what covers it, within 3, 16 and 80 km of Presidente Dutra.

Within 3 km, the terrain around Presidente Dutra has only modest vari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 61 m around an average of 103 m above sea level; within 16 km, only modest vari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 178 m; within 80 km, significant vari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 392 m.

The land around Presidente Dutra is covered by grassland (50%) and trees (26%) within 3 km, grassland (61%) and trees (37%) within 16 km, and trees (59%) and grassland (39%) within 80 km.
